ステージングブランチとは何ですか?
質問者:Amatallah Andronic |最終更新日:2020年4月21日
カテゴリ:テクノロジーとコンピューティングのWebホスティング
環境ブランチでは、ブランチに直接変更をコミットする必要はありません。安定したブランチからステージングブランチまたは本番ブランチにコードをマージするだけで、変更が一方向に流れるようになります。機能およびバグ修正ブランチから安定したステージング環境へ、そして安定したものから本番環境へ。
ここで、Gitステージングブランチとは何ですか?開発、ステージング、本番ブランチを備えたgit 。マージは一方向にのみ流れる必要があります。独自のブランチまたは開発中に行われた機能とバグ修正から、テスト用のステージングまでです。テストが完了すると、これらの変更を開発から本番にマージできます。
次に、Rustステージングブランチをダウンロードする必要がありますか? Rustのステージングバージョンは、通常のバージョンと同じようにインストールできます。あなたのゲームのリストにある-あなたが錆を所有している場合、あなたは、「ステージング錆」を参照してくださいする必要があります。ステージングバージョンはリリースバージョンと互換性がないため、ステージングバージョンでリリースサーバーに参加することはできません。
これに加えて、コードブランチとは何ですか?
バージョン管理およびソフトウェア構成管理における分岐とは、バージョン管理下にあるオブジェクト(ソースコードファイルやディレクトリツリーなど)の複製であり、複数の分岐に沿って並行して変更を行うことができます。ブランチは、ツリー、ストリーム、またはコードラインとも呼ばれます。
ブランチはどのように使用しますか?
実行する手順は次のとおりです。
- GitHubでリポジトリをフォークします。
- コンピューターにクローンします。
- ブランチを作成して移動します:git checkout -bfixingBranch。
- ファイルに変更を加えます。
- 履歴への変更をコミットします。
- ブランチをフォークバージョンにプッシュします:git push originfixingBranch。
39関連する質問の回答が見つかりました
いつコードを分岐する必要がありますか?
1つのブランチで2つの開発作業を追跡および記録できない場合は、ブランチする必要があります。 (維持するための恐ろしく複雑な履歴を持たずに)。ブランチは、ソースコードを操作しているのがあなただけの場合でも、多数の場合でも役立ちます。
異なる分岐戦略とは何ですか?
分岐戦略
- トランクベースの開発(分岐なし)
- 分岐を解放します。
- 機能の分岐。
- ストーリーまたはタスクの分岐。
- 手動のコードレビューとマージ。
- 最小限の継続的インテグレーション。
- 品質ゲートを備えた継続的インテグレーションパイプライン。
bitbucketは何に使用されますか?
Bitbucketは、Atlassianが所有するバージョン管理リポジトリをホストするためのシステムです。 GitHubのライバルです。バージョン管理システムは、時間の経過とともに変化するプロジェクトのコードを管理するのに役立つツールです。新しい変更によって問題が発生した場合に備えて、プロジェクトの過去のバージョンを保存できます。
分岐のベストプラクティスは何ですか?
分岐とマージのためのかなり良いプラクティス
- 標準のソース管理フォルダ構造を正しく使用してください。
- プロジェクトで使用されている戦略を理解します。
- ブランチの数を最小限に抑えるようにしてください。
- リリースの依存関係を予測します。
- 定期的にマージしてください。
- リポジトリの選択の影響について考えてください。
プルリクエストとは何ですか?
プルリクエスト(PR)は、オープンな開発プロジェクトに貢献を提出する方法です。これは、開発者が外部リポジトリにコミットされた変更を、ピアレビュー後にプロジェクトのメインリポジトリに含めることを検討するように要求した場合に発生します。
機能ブランチをチェックアウトするにはどうすればよいですか?
Gitを使用してコマンドラインでブランチをチェックアウトする
ローカルリポジトリのルートに変更します。 Bitbucketのローカルブランチとリモートブランチの両方が一覧表示されていることに注意してください。リストを参照として使用して、チェックアウトするブランチを選択します。この例では、機能ブランチはブランチです。 gitブランチをデプロイするにはどうすればよいですか?
展開したい場所へ。 gitのチェックアウト-b展開起源/マスターを実行します。変更を加えます(必要に応じてプッシュします)。マスター(またはデプロイを行ったブランチ)にデプロイしたい変更がある場合は、 git pull--rebaseを実行するだけです。
Gitリリースを管理するにはどうすればよいですか?
gitによるソフトウェアリリース管理
- マスター、メインブランチ、マスターブランチは1つだけ存在する必要があります。
- 開発、開発ブランチ、開発ブランチは1つだけ存在する必要があります。
- テストブランチには、複数のテストブランチが存在する可能性があります。
- 機能ブランチには、複数の機能ブランチが存在する可能性があります。
- リリースブランチには、複数のリリースブランチが存在する可能性があります。
単純な分岐とは何ですか?
単純なアジャイル分岐戦略
誰もがトランクから働きます。コードをリリースするときに分岐します。すでにリリースされているコードのバグ修正を作成する必要がある場合は、リリースを分岐します。プロトタイプのブランチ。 銀行の支店コードとは何ですか?
支店コード:支店コードは、銀行の特定の支店の一意の識別コードです。銀行の各支店は、その支店コードによって区別されます。これらのブランチコード[1]は、世界中でさまざまな名前で知られています。
コード分岐はどのように機能しますか?
分岐により、開発者のチームは1つの中央コードベース内で簡単に共同作業を行うことができます。開発者がブランチを作成すると、バージョン管理システムはその時点でコードベースのコピーを作成します。ブランチへの変更は、チームの他の開発者には影響しません。
ソートコードはブランチコードと同じですか?
ソートコード(「ブランチソートコード」と呼ばれることもあります)は、必要なもう1つのキー番号です。これは、アカウントが保持されている銀行の支店を識別する6桁の番号です。数字は通常、ペアでグループ化されます。たとえば、英国のN26アカウントはすべて、同じ並べ替えコード04-00-26を共有しています。
壮大な枝とは何ですか?
壮大なブランチは、相互に依存する機能のより大きなセットで作業するために使用できます。壮大な枝はマスターから切り取られます。叙事詩のための機能ブランチは叙事詩からカットされています。これは、叙事詩がマスターと同じくらいきれいであるが、扶養家族のために叙事詩に属するものも含んでいることを前提としています。
分岐とマージとは何ですか?
チェックアウトは、あるブランチから別のブランチに切り替えるプロセスであるため、サイトの間違ったバージョンに変更を加えることはありません。最後に、 mergeは2つの異なるブランチを1つにまとめ、2つの異なるバージョンからサイトの1つのバージョンを効果的に作成します。
機能ブランチにプッシュするにはどうすればよいですか?
新しいローカルブランチをリモートのGitリポジトリにプッシュし、それも追跡します
- 新しいブランチを作成します:git checkout -bfeature_branch_name。
- ファイルを編集、追加、コミットします。
- ブランチをリモートリポジトリにプッシュします:git push -u originfeature_branch_name。
コードマージとは何ですか?
バージョン管理では、マージ(統合とも呼ばれます)は、バージョン管理されたファイルのコレクションに加えられた複数の変更を調整する基本的な操作です。ほとんどの場合、ファイルが2つの独立したブランチで変更され、その後マージされるときに必要になります。
ブランチコードとIFSCコードの違いは何ですか?
主な違い:インドの銀行との関連で、どちらも一意のコードを参照します。 IFSCは、インド金融システムコードの略です。 IFSCコードは11文字で構成されており、銀行と銀行の支店を識別するために使用されます。ブランチコードは、銀行支店のための識別コードとして機能する数です。